# Locations & Schedules

## Meeting Locations and Schedules

Each club may have multiple locations and various schedules (**Club Information** > **Locations** or **Schedules**). A schedule is always linked to a specific location. Therefore, it is necessary to establish the potential location(s) prior to creating a schedule.

**LOCATION = The site where the club gathers.**

**SCHEDULE = The timetable showing when the club convenes.**

Locations are generally restaurants or venues where the club gathers on a regular or occasional basis. A virtual meeting with a fixed address can also be regarded as a location.

### Locations

The schedules and locations are displayed in the footer on the club's home page, including a route planner and a google map. If there are several schedules, the display changes every 4 seconds. If no schedule or location is defined, or if they are not linked together, an empty footer appears.

On the left and right sides of the blue area, there are arrows for navigating through the schedules.

The name is sufficient for the description of the location, but in order for the map and directions to be displayed, it is necessary to enter the complete postal address.

### Schedules

You need to specify the day of the week and the meeting's duration. Furthermore, you will determine the location, along with some standard settings for the meetings.

If your meetings take place at different times depending on the week of the month, or if your schedules are different in summer and winter, create related schedules and describe the specific rules in the content tab of the schedule.

> [!WARNING]
> ** VISIBILITY
> 
> You need to activate the schedule's visibility; otherwise, it won't appear in the footer on the homepage.
